Tea Stains on Titanium: Tannin Film vs Patina

Guide card on diagnosing and removing tea stains and tannin film from titanium cups

The brown film inside your titanium cup is tea residue sitting on top of the metal — tannins and tea oils, not a stain in the surface — and a baking-soda paste removes it completely whenever you decide you want it gone. That "whenever you decide" is the interesting part. In tea culture, a darkened cup can be a badge of devotion rather than a hygiene lapse, and titanium is one of the few materials where you genuinely get to choose: keep the film as character, or wipe the cup back to bright metal in two minutes. This guide shows you how to tell tea film from every other discolouration titanium can show, how to remove it cleanly, and where the keep-it-or-clean-it line sensibly sits.

Diagnose first: what is actually on your cup?

Before you scrub anything, identify what you are looking at — because one of the four common discolourations should not be scrubbed at all, and another cannot be. The test is simple: tea film wipes or fades under a damp cloth with baking soda; oxide colours do not budge because they are the metal's own surface.

What you see What it is Wipes off? What to do
Brown or amber film, heaviest at the waterline and bottom Tannin and tea-oil residue deposited by repeated brews Yes — baking-soda paste Remove, or deliberately keep (see below)
Rainbow, straw or blue sheen, often near heat sources Heat tint — a thickened oxide layer bending light No Leave it; it is harmless and many owners like it — see our heat tint guide
Uniform factory colour (gold, blue, violet) on the whole vessel Ti-Anox structural colour — deliberate anodized oxide, not paint No, and never scour it Nothing; it is the design
Cloudy white mineral haze, gritty rings Hard-water scale, not tea at all Yes — mild acid such as diluted vinegar, then rinse Descale, then return to normal washing

The confusion between the first two rows causes most owner anxiety. Tea film builds gradually, follows where liquid sits, and darkens with your brewing habits; heat tint appears in zones that saw heat, shimmers with viewing angle, and arrived suddenly. If yours is the shimmering kind, read our rainbow heat tint guide — and put the scouring pad away, because scrubbing cannot remove an oxide colour and aggressive abrasion only mars the finish around it.

Takeaway: damp cloth plus baking soda is the diagnostic — residue fades, oxide colours stay, and only residue was ever yours to remove.

Why titanium cannot truly stain

Understanding this changes how you clean forever. Porous and glazed materials stain structurally: unglazed clay drinks in tea liquor by design, ceramic glazes develop microscopic crack networks (crazing) that trap tannins where no brush reaches, and plastic absorbs tea compounds into the polymer itself. In all three, the colour is inside the material — which is why bleach soaks and harsh chemistry get recruited, and why old mugs never quite come back.

Titanium offers tannins nothing to enter. The surface is dense, non-porous metal protected by a continuous oxide layer; there is no glaze to craze, no polymer to penetrate, and on a TAIC vessel no coating of any kind — 99.8% pure titanium, bare inside and out. Tea residue can only lie on top, held by nothing stronger than its own stickiness. That is why removal never escalates: the film's grip does not deepen with time the way stains embed in crazed ceramic. A cup with a year of tea film cleans as completely as a cup with a week of it.

This is also why the choice to keep the film is reversible in a way it is not for clay. Season a porous teapot and the seasoning is permanent; let film build in titanium and you can change your mind next Tuesday. The removal routine, from gentle to thorough

When you do want bright metal back, escalate in this order and stop at the first level that works:

  1. Hot water and a soft sponge. Fresh, light film often surrenders immediately. Do this soon after emptying the last brew and heavier measures may never be needed.
  2. Baking-soda paste. Mix baking soda with a little water into toothpaste consistency, rub over the film with a cloth or sponge in small circles, let it sit briefly, rinse. This clears established film completely and is the workhorse method.
  3. A soak for the stubborn corners. Fill the vessel with hot water and a spoonful of baking soda, leave it while you do something better, then wipe. The soak loosens film in tight geometry — infuser baskets, under-rim curves — that fingers miss.
  4. A non-scratch pad for the last ghost. On plain (non-Ti-Anox) interiors, a gentle non-scratch pad finishes any shadow the paste left. Skip this step entirely on coloured or mirror-finished surfaces.

Two standing prohibitions: no chlorine bleach — titanium dislikes it, and nothing about tea film requires it — and no steel wool or aggressive scouring, which cannot remove film any faster but can leave scratches. The case for keeping it: seasoning culture meets titanium

Now the heresy your grandmother's dish soap does not want you to hear: you are allowed to keep the film. In gongfu tradition, vessels that darken with years of tea are read the way a chef reads a carbon-steel pan — as evidence of practice. A titanium master cup with an amber-toned interior says its owner brews daily, and some owners find a genuine (if debated) mellowing in how a well-used cup presents aroma. Whatever the sensory truth, the aesthetic is real: warm tea tones over satin metal is a handsome look, halfway between patina and lacquer.

Titanium is arguably the ideal canvas for this choice because it is consequence-free. The film sits on inert, non-porous metal, so it cannot turn rancid within the surface, cannot harbour anything a rinse-and-dry does not address, and — unlike true seasoning — can be fully reversed the day you tire of it.

Sensible house rules if you keep it: rinse the cup with hot water after each session and dry it; keep the rim, lid and any gasket genuinely clean, since lips and seals are where hygiene lives; reserve the film for dedicated tea vessels rather than cups that rotate through coffee and juice; and give even a treasured film an occasional full reset, letting it rebuild — tea drinkers before you would call that respect for the cup. Prevention, for those who want permanent bright

If your taste runs to gleaming metal, prevention is nearly free. Film needs two ingredients: tea compounds and dwell time. Remove either and the cup stays bright with no scrubbing career required.

Empty vessels when the session ends rather than letting the last pour stand — overnight tea is the single biggest film-builder. Rinse with hot water immediately after emptying; residue that never dries never grips. Dry with a cloth rather than air-drying if your water is hard, which also heads off mineral haze. Once a week or so, give the interior a ten-second baking-soda wipe as maintenance, which costs less effort than one quarterly deep clean. And note what is absent from this list: nothing about your brewing needs to change. Brew as dark and as often as you like — prevention is entirely about what happens after the cup empties.

Infuser tumblers deserve one extra habit: pop the basket out and rinse it separately, since mesh and perforations give film its favourite hiding places and are tedious to reclaim once established.

Takeaway: empty promptly, rinse hot, dry — film cannot form on a surface tea never dries onto.

Frequently asked questions

Why is my titanium cup turning brown inside?

Repeated brewing deposits tannins and tea oils on the surface, building an amber-to-brown film — the same residue that stains ceramic mugs. On titanium it is purely superficial: the non-porous metal absorbs nothing, so a baking-soda paste removes the film completely whenever you choose.

Are tea stains on titanium harmful?

No. The film is dried tea compounds on an inert metal surface — unsightly to some, characterful to others, dangerous to no one. Keep the rim and lid clean and rinse after use, and a filmed interior poses no hygiene issue. Remove it entirely if you prefer; either choice is safe.

How do I remove tea stains without scratching my cup?

Use baking-soda paste on a soft cloth or sponge — it is mildly abrasive enough to lift film but far too gentle to mark titanium. For stubborn spots, soak first with hot water and baking soda. Avoid steel wool and harsh scouring pads; they add scratches, not cleaning power.

Is the colour on my cup tea stain or heat tint?

Wipe it with a damp cloth and baking soda: tea film fades or streaks, heat tint does not move. Film is brown, builds where liquid sits and grows gradually; heat tint is rainbow-to-blue, shimmers with viewing angle and appears where the vessel met heat. Only film is removable.

Can I let my titanium tea cup "season" like a Yixing pot?

You can keep the visual patina, but true seasoning does not occur — titanium is non-porous, so nothing enters the metal the way tea liquor enters clay. The film is surface-deep and fully reversible, which many owners consider the best of both worlds: the look of devotion, none of the permanence.

Will bleach get my titanium cup white-bright faster?

Skip bleach entirely. Chlorine is one of the few chemicals worth keeping away from titanium, and it offers no advantage: baking soda removes tea film completely on its own. If you want maximum brightness, finish with a gentle non-scratch pad on plain interiors — never on Ti-Anox colour.
